Who qualifies to fill out the High Value Homes Insurance Application?
The application can be filled out by homeowners of high-value properties and their appointed agents. Both parties must have accurate information for a successful application.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the application?
While there may not be a strict deadline, it is advisable to submit your application as soon as possible to ensure timely processing for adequate coverage, especially during peak insurance seasons.
How should I submit the completed application?
You can submit the application through pdfFiller by emailing it directly or printing it out for physical submission. Confirm the method preferred by your insurance provider.
What supporting documents are needed with the application?
It is often necessary to provide proof of property ownership, previous insurance documents, and identification. Check with your insurer for specific requirements.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Ensure all sections are completed fully and accurately, particularly personal and property details. Double-check calculations related to coverage amounts to avoid discrepancies.
What is the processing time for this application?
Processing times can vary, but typically allow for 2 to 4 weeks. Check with your insurance agent for specific timelines based on your provider's protocols.
Is notarization required for the High Value Homes Insurance Application?
No, notarization is not required for this application. However, it must be signed by both the applicant and the agent.
